Staff Product Designer

Responsibilities:

  • Lead end-to-end design for multiple complex product initiatives, delivering both UX and UI solutions that enhance user adoption, conversion, and satisfaction.
  • Translate user research, customer feedback, and business goals into actionable design solutions and interactive prototypes.
  • Contribute to the evolution and maintenance of design systems and pattern libraries to ensure consistency and scalability across products.
  • Collaborate closely with Product Managers, Engineers, and cross-functional teams to define product vision, roadmap, and strategy.
  • Mentor and guide junior designers, fostering professional growth and promoting a strong design culture.
  • Identify areas for product improvement and optimize usability, accessibility, and overall user experience.
  • Present and articulate design decisions clearly to diverse stakeholders, grounding recommendations in user insights, business objectives, and technical constraints.

Skills:

  • Minimum of 8 years of experience in product design, with a strong focus on B2B or B2B2C products.
  • Proven ability to take features from ideation through to final delivery, including user research, usability testing, and collaboration with engineering.
  • Strong visual design skills with experience creating high-fidelity mockups and prototypes.
  • Systems-level thinking with the ability to design scalable solutions across multiple platforms.
  • Experience building or contributing to design systems and pattern libraries.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ills to effectively convey complex design concepts to cross-functional teams.
  • Bias toward action and ownership mentality, able to manage ambiguity while delivering end-to-end solutions.
  • Bonus: Experience in FinTech, particularly credit or risk-related products, and familiarity with consumer-permissioned data.
